Any other opinion about changing oil before or after hibernation?
It seems they all make sense, how about what the dealer say?
Is not the new oil sitting over winter months will get contaminated with moisture as well? So, new oil again after winter?
I like to be in oil business....
You do not need to change it after sitting all winter. UoA's show the oil, providing it was a quality oil and fresh in the first place, is just fine after sitting for months.............
